So, what exactly is coaching for leaders, and why is it so important? coaching for leaders is a process of communication and collaboration that aims to enhance the performance and development of individuals within an organization. It involves providing guidance, support, and feedback to help individuals set goals, identify their strengths and weaknesses, and develop their skills and capabilities. Through coaching, leaders can empower their team members to overcome challenges, improve their performance, and achieve their full potential.
One of the key benefits of coaching for leaders is that it fosters a culture of continuous learning and growth within an organization. When leaders take the time to coach their team members, they demonstrate a commitment to their development and success. This, in turn, motivates team members to be more engaged, productive, and proactive in their roles. By investing in coaching, leaders can create a positive and empowering work environment where team members feel supported, valued, and encouraged to take on new challenges.
coaching for leaders also helps to improve communication and collaboration within a team. By regularly meeting with team members to discuss their goals, progress, and challenges, leaders can build stronger relationships based on trust and respect. This open and honest communication not only promotes transparency and accountability but also enables leaders to better understand the needs and aspirations of their team members. By listening to their concerns, offering guidance, and providing feedback, leaders can create a supportive and collaborative work environment where everyone feels heard and valued.
Furthermore, coaching for leaders can enhance individual and team performance. By helping team members set clear goals, develop action plans, and track their progress, leaders can drive accountability and results. Coaching enables leaders to identify areas for improvement, provide targeted feedback, and offer support and resources to help team members succeed. By fostering a culture of continuous improvement and development, coaching can boost productivity, innovation, and overall performance within an organization.
Moreover, coaching for leaders can also help to develop and retain top talent. In today’s competitive market, attracting and retaining skilled professionals is crucial for organizational success. By investing in coaching for leaders, organizations can demonstrate a commitment to their employees’ growth and development, making them more attractive to top talent. Coaching can help to build a pipeline of future leaders, nurture emerging talent, and engage high-potential employees, thus ensuring a strong and sustainable leadership bench within an organization.
To be effective, coaching for leaders should be a collaborative and ongoing process that is tailored to the needs and preferences of individual team members. Leaders should take the time to build rapport with their team members, establish trust and rapport, and create a safe and supportive environment for open and honest communication. By asking powerful questions, active listening, and providing constructive feedback, leaders can help their team members gain valuable insights, reflect on their performance, and develop new skills and perspectives.
